1. HelloFresh

Insert Image

HelloFresh ships you ingredients for healthy meals straight to your door so you can quickly and easily prepare meals for yourself and your family. There are several meal kit options available through this company, including Veggie, Meat & Veggies, Family Friendly, and Low Calories. They offer meal plans for two or four people, and you can choose between receiving two, three, or four recipes a week.

You get to choose from a variety of options for meals each week so you can choose things that appeal to you. You’ll also have the chance to see allergens, ingredients, and nutritional information in the process. Recipes come in levels based on difficulty so you can select Level 1 simple meals, Level 2 intermediate meals, and Level 3 expert meals.

Highlighted Features

  • Offers a variety of menus for different palates and is a healthy alternative to takeout and restaurant dining
  • Features some menus for restricted diets so everyone can enjoy the dishes on offer each week
  • Includes meals that can easily be created by beginners so you can learn and become more confident

Cost

Meals from HelloFresh start at $8.99 per serving for a couple and $7.49 per serving for a family of four, plus $7.99 shipping

Availability

HelloFresh offers meal kits to individuals in the 48 continental states and may deliver to Hawaii and Alaska in the future.


2. Blue Apron

Insert Image

Blue Apron is best known for offering meals designed by chefs to be delicious but also simple and easy to make in your home. Creating an account is easy and will give you the option to choose between three meal plans: the Vegetarian for two, the Signature for two, and the Signature for four. The menu is constantly changing and includes Weight Watcher approved, Beyond Meat, and diabetes-friendly recipes.

One of the perks is that there are many diverse vegetarian meals and the meal service also has a wine delivery attached that can be paired with your meals. This is an excellent option for those who want fast foods that taste good, as most of the recipes take 30 minutes to make at most. It mainly caters to beginner to intermediate level cooks.

Highlighted Features

  • Meals are conveniently delivered in an ice-packed box to ensure freshness and quality
  • Ability to choose from eight meal options each week for two people or a family of four
  • Offers delivery seven days a week and has partnerships with artisanal and family-run farms with sustainable practices

Cost

Meals for families of four start at $8.99 a serving while meals for couples start at $9.99 a serving

Availability

Blue Apron offers meal kits to all states in the lower 48 of the United States at this time.


3. Home Chef

Insert Image

Home Chef starts you out by filling out a taste profile that will recommend dishes that fit your palate and adhere to any dietary restrictions that you might have. Each Monday, you’ll get an email with 21 meal options to choose from and you have until midday Friday to make your final decisions. Some of the dietary restrictions catered to by Home Chef are vegetarian, non-dairy, non-nut, carb-conscious, non-soy, carb-conscious, and non-wheat.

A highlight of this food box delivery is that you can make changes to the protein to meet your needs, such as swapping out the chicken for beef or even tofu. It also includes clear instructions that are categorized by the level of difficulty so you can choose meals you are capable of making quickly and easily. In addition, all ingredients come fresh and measured out, so all you have to worry about is the cooking.

Highlighted Features

  • Offers a wide selection of easy-to-follow recipes designed for a home cook of any skill level
  • Includes ingredients that are packaged by the meal for an extra dose of convenience in the kitchen
  • Includes quick meals, vegetarian meals, low-calorie meals, low carb meals, and more

Cost

Dinners are $9.99 a serving, while lunch is $7.99 a serving with free shipping on orders over $40; optional additions like smoothies or fruit cost $4.95 per serving

Availability

 Home Chef offers delivery to all 48 of the lower states in the United States.

13. Sun Basket

Insert Image

Sun Basket is another subscription for meals that offer healthy diet options and that can be made in as little as five minutes. There are three types of meals you can choose from, including oven and microwave-ready meals, pre-prepped meals to save time, and classic cooking recipes where the prep and cooking is up to you. All of the meals incorporate fresh organic produce for a healthy dining experience.

Each subscription starts with two or more dinners, and you can then add on lunches, breakfasts, snacks, and other items. Some of the other things to be aware of with Sun Basket are that orders come cold packed to your door, and you can easily skip a week or cancel your subscription whenever you like.

Highlighted Features

  • Features a delivery kit with two or three dinner recipes, ingredients and instructions every week
  • Option to choose between two people or four people with special diets like paleo, vegetarian, gluten-free, and more
  • Offers breakfast, lunch, dinner snacks, and groceries including pasta and fresh proteins

Cost

Each serving is $10.99, $11.99, or $12.99 depending on the number of servings and meals bought for the week

Availability

Sun Basket ships to most states except for parts of Montana, New Mexico, and North Dakota, as well as all of Alaska and Hawaii.

Buyer’s Guide for the Best Meal Subscription Boxes

There are dozens of meal services today that deliver straight to your front door, and it seems like new ones are always popping up. They make an excellent option for those who don’t have time for meal prepping and shopping for groceries since all of that is handled for you. However, before you pick a meal kit for your household, there are a few things to be aware of.

What to Expect in Your First Box

Once you’ve chosen the right meal delivery service for you, you may be wondering what to expect from your first box. Every kit is going to be different, but many have things in common, such as:

  • First Box Discounts – Most services offer a hefty discount on the first box to get you started with their meals. This is always worth taking advantage of so that you get some savings when you start out.
  • Boxes Can Sit at the Door – Since your delivery can come at any point in the day, meal delivery services package ingredients to stay safe throughout the day until you can get to them. Most package items with ice packs and insulation to keep cold items at the correct temperature.
  • Packaging Can Be Overwhelming – While some packaging is more eco-friendly than others, there’s often a lot of packaging to get rid of after you unpack things. This might matter if you already have overflowing dumpsters or trash cans at your home.
  • Seasonal Recipes and Favorites Are Expected – All meal services have their own approach for repeating meals, but they often add seasonal items so the options don’t get boring and stale. However, the most popular meals will typically pop up time and time again so that you can try it again later.
  • Meals Should Be Prepared ASAP – The ingredients in kits are often fresh and of a high quality, but they don’t have preservatives, so you want to cook the meals quickly. Items like fresh greens, seafood, and chicken should be the first items you cook.

Sizes of Meal Kits

Some meal kits are made for a single person, but most are created for a couple or a family of four. However, it doesn’t matter too much exactly how many people you’re buying for; there’s likely a meal option that fits your needs. Keep in mind that even if you’re alone or a couple, larger food kits can be useful for leftovers if you want to save money. The reality is that most companies have cheaper servings when you buy larger packages.
